This side-by-side compares ZIP 28343 (Gibson, NC) and ZIP 28351 (Laurel Hill, NC) using the same Census ACS 5-Year table fields for both — no averages swapped in, no national proxies. ZIP 28343 has a population of 1,685 at 36 people per square mile, while ZIP 28351 has 4,759 at 32 per square mile. That difference in population size and density alone reshapes how every other metric should be interpreted — a higher-income ZIP with 1,200 residents behaves very differently from one with 45,000.

On income and education, ZIP 28343 reports a median household income of $29,306 against $50,156 in ZIP 28351, with per-capita income of $16,803 vs $28,202. The share of adults holding a bachelor's degree or higher is 4.1% in 28343 and 13.5% in 28351. Poverty rate reads 33.2% vs 27.9%, and unemployment 14.1% vs 8.5% — these four fields alone drive most of the difference in the scorecard grades you will see for each ZIP.

Housing separates these two ZIPs further: median home value sits at $80,700 in 28343 versus $88,200 in 28351, with median rent of $765 and $819 per month respectively. Homeownership rate is 53.6% vs 73.0%.
